Understanding the Steering Knuckle: Function and Importance
A steering knuckle, also known as a stub axle or upright, is a critical component in a vehicle’s suspension and steering system. It serves as the pivot point for the front wheels, connecting the wheel hub, brake caliper, and suspension arms to the steering mechanism. Typically forged or cast from high-strength steel or ductile iron, the steering knuckle must withstand immense loads, including braking torque, cornering forces, and road impacts. Failure of this part can lead to catastrophic loss of vehicle control, making material integrity and precision manufacturing non-negotiable.

Key Factors in Choosing a Chinese Manufacturer
Selecting the right Chinese factory requires evaluating multiple criteria beyond price. First, verify ISO/TS 16949 certification, which is mandatory for automotive parts. Second, assess their material sourcing—whether they use domestic steel (e.g., from Baowu) or imported alloys. Third, evaluate their CNC machining capabilities: 5-axis machines indicate higher precision. Fourth, check their quality control processes, including CMM (Coordinate Measuring Machine) reports and tensile testing. Fifth, request samples and conduct a third-party inspection via SGS or Bureau Veritas. Finally, consider their logistics network—factories near Shanghai or Ningbo ports reduce shipping time.

Applications and Solutions for Steering Knuckles
Steering knuckles are used in diverse vehicle types, each requiring specific design adaptations. For passenger cars, lightweight aluminum knuckles reduce unsprung mass, improving fuel efficiency. For heavy trucks, forged steel knuckles with reinforced bearing pockets handle higher axle loads. In electric vehicles, knuckles must accommodate regenerative braking systems and higher torque from electric motors. A common solution is using nodular cast iron (GJS-500-7) for its fatigue resistance. For off-road vehicles, manufacturers apply a manganese phosphate coating to prevent corrosion. In racing applications, titanium alloy knuckles offer the best strength-to-weight ratio.
Frequently Asked Questions (10 Common Queries)
- What material is best for steering knuckles? Ductile iron (GJS-600-3) is standard for cost and strength; forged steel (4140) is used for heavy loads; aluminum 6061-T6 for lightweight EVs.
- How long does a steering knuckle last? Typically 100,000-150,000 miles, but this varies with driving conditions and maintenance.
- Can a bent steering knuckle be repaired? No, it must be replaced; bending indicates metal fatigue and risk of fracture.
- What is the difference between a steering knuckle and a spindle? A knuckle is the entire upright; a spindle is the shaft that the wheel hub mounts onto.
- Do Chinese manufacturers offer custom designs? Yes, most provide OEM/ODM services with CAD file submission.
- What is the typical lead time for a Chinese factory? 30-45 days for standard parts; 60-90 days for custom designs.
- How to check quality of a steering knuckle? Request a material test certificate (MTC) and a dimensional inspection report.
- What is the MOQ for Chinese suppliers? Usually 500-1000 units for forged parts; 100-300 for cast parts.
- Are Chinese steering knuckles safe? Yes, if sourced from ISO/TS 16949 certified factories with proper testing.
- What is the price range for a steering knuckle? $15-$50 for aftermarket cast iron; $80-$200 for OEM forged steel; $150-$400 for aluminum.
Procurement Considerations for Steering Knuckles
When purchasing steering knuckles, first define the load rating required—use FEA (Finite Element Analysis) data from your design team. Specify the surface treatment: e-coating for corrosion resistance, powder coating for durability, or zinc-nickel plating for high-end applications. Ensure the supplier provides a PPAP (Production Part Approval Process) Level 3 submission. Negotiate warranty terms: minimum 12 months or 50,000 km. Include a clause for dimensional verification using a 3D scanner. Finally, plan for tariff costs—steering knuckles fall under HS code 8708.99, which may have anti-dumping duties in certain regions.

Industry Standards for Steering Knuckles
Steering knuckles must comply with several international standards. ISO 898-1 defines mechanical properties of fasteners used in knuckle assemblies. SAE J434 specifies ductile iron castings for automotive use. ASTM A536 covers the standard specification for ductile iron castings. For aluminum, ASTM B209 is relevant. The European standard EN 1563 governs spheroidal graphite cast iron. Additionally, many OEMs have proprietary standards, such as Ford’s WSS-M2C186-A or GM’s GMW14792. Always request a certificate of conformance to these standards.

Customs Data and Tariff Rates for Steering Knuckles
Steering knuckles are classified under HS code 8708.99 (Other parts and accessories of motor vehicles). The general MFN tariff rate for imports into the USA is 2.5% for most countries, but Chinese-origin parts may face an additional Section 301 tariff of 25%, bringing the total to 27.5%. For the EU, the standard duty is 4.5%. For India, the import duty is 15% plus a social welfare surcharge of 10%. Always check the latest HTSUS (Harmonized Tariff Schedule of the United States) before shipping. Use a customs broker to calculate landed costs including VAT/GST.
Why Choose Small to Medium Factories vs. Large Enterprises
Small and medium-sized factories (SMEs) in China offer distinct advantages for certain buyers. They are more flexible with custom designs and smaller MOQs (as low as 50 units). Their overhead is lower, resulting in 10-20% lower prices compared to large factories. They often provide faster turnaround times for prototypes. However, large factories have superior quality control systems, more advanced automation, and better financial stability. Large factories can handle high-volume orders (100,000+ units) with consistent quality. For critical safety parts like steering knuckles, large factories are generally preferred for OEM applications, while SMEs are suitable for aftermarket or niche applications.

Customer and Market Pain Points in Steering Knuckle Sourcing
Buyers face several recurring challenges. Quality inconsistency is the top concern—variations in hardness or dimensional tolerances can lead to premature failure. Counterfeit parts are a significant risk in the aftermarket, with fake OEM-branded knuckles made from inferior materials. Long lead times, especially for custom designs, disrupt production schedules. Communication barriers with Chinese factories often result in misunderstandings about specifications. Tariff volatility creates cost unpredictability. Finally, lack of traceability in the supply chain makes it difficult to identify the root cause of defects. Solutions include using third-party inspection services, demanding full material traceability, and establishing long-term partnerships with verified suppliers.
